Perturbations in the K = 1 and 3 levels of the [Formula: see text], 4ν3 state of acetylene are explained as interactions with levels of the [Formula: see text], 31B4 (v3 = 1, v4 + v6 = 4) polyad. A satisfactory least-squares fit to the perturbed level structure has been obtained, treating the 4ν3 state as an asymmetric top perturbed by isolated K = 1 and 3 levels. Accurate deperturbed rotational constants for the interacting states are presented.
